Transaction afad30afba446576dcd026ba62f382fae10a5ff67ffb1fd5ffaeec75419586da

1 Input
2 Outputs
  • afad30afba446576dcd026ba62f382fae10a5ff67ffb1fd5ffaeec75419586da:0
  • value  731592
    address  37vzaxjncRFXodeawh4QHb91tpH8KrZLcC
  • afad30afba446576dcd026ba62f382fae10a5ff67ffb1fd5ffaeec75419586da:1
  • value  655438
    address  3HQh8KvARx56kCdSsRUbMPRvJuZCytCJPv